    Alleged Plot by Siblings to Target ICE Agents in Las Vegas Uncovered

    Coordinated Vegas Trip Linked to Planned Assault on ICE Officers

    Federal authorities have disclosed that two brothers orchestrated a trip to Las Vegas as part of a broader scheme to attack U.S. Immigration and Customs Enforcement (ICE) personnel. Court documents reveal that the siblings meticulously arranged travel logistics while simultaneously plotting violent actions against federal agents. The Department of Homeland Security (DHS) stressed that this excursion was a calculated component of their plan rather than a casual visit, raising meaningful security alarms.

    Evidence presented in court highlights:

    • Recorded conversations detailing both the Vegas itinerary and attack strategies
    • Digital forensic data linking travel arrangements with preparatory activities
    • Surveillance videos confirming timelines and movements
    • Law enforcement testimonies emphasizing the gravity of the threat
